Garmin Connect sync:
- Incremental syncs now re-fetch only a 1-day buffer (yesterday + today)
instead of the full lookback window every run. Full lookback applies on
the first sync only. Cuts steady-state API calls ~10x.
- Beat interval is now configurable via GARMIN_SYNC_INTERVAL_MINUTES and
surfaced to the UI; the sync toggle is relabelled to the real cadence.

- Pace: FIT 0xFFFF sentinel (65.535 m/s) was stored as avg_speed_ms on every
activity and lap; add _sanitize_speed() to parser falling back to dist/dur,
plus a startup SQL migration that fixed 120 activities and 688 laps in-place
